JAVA-for循环
for循环
public class forDemo1 {
public static void main ( String[ ] args) {
for ( int i = 0 ; i < 100 ; i++ ) {
System. out. println ( i) ;
}
}
}
100以内奇数偶数和和
public class forDemo2 {
public static void main ( String[ ] args) {
int oddSum = 0 ;
int eveSum = 0 ;
for ( int i = 0 ; i <= 100 ; i++ ) {
if ( i % 2 == 0 ) {
oddSum += i;
} else {
eveSum += i;
}
}
System. out. println ( "奇数的和为:" + oddSum) ;
System. out. println ( "偶数的和为:" + eveSum) ;
System. out. println ( "总和为:" + oddSum+ eveSum) ;
}
}
用while或for循环输出1-1000之间能被5整除的数,并且每行输出3个
public class forDemo3 {
public static void main ( String[ ] args) {
for ( int i = 0 ; i <= 1000 ; i++ ) {
if ( i% 5 == 0 )
{
System. out. print ( i+ "\t" ) ;
}
if ( i% 15 == 0 ) {
System. out. println ( ) ;
}
}
System. out. println ( "============================" ) ;
int a= 0 ;
while ( a<= 1000 ) {
a++ ;
if ( a% 5 == 0 ) {
System. out. print ( a+ "\t" ) ;
}
if ( a% 15 == 0 ) {
System. out. println ( ) ;
}
}
}
}
打印九九乘法表
public class forDemo4 {
public static void main ( String[ ] args) {
for ( int i = 1 ; i <= 9 ; i++ ) {
for ( int j = 1 ; j <= i; j++ ) {
System. out. print ( i+ "*" + j+ "=" + ( i* j) + "\t" ) ;
}
System. out. println ( ) ;
}
}
}
遍历数组元素
public class forDemo5 {
public static void main ( String[ ] args) {
int [ ] number= { 1 , 2 , 3 , 4 , 5 } ;
for ( int x: number) {
System. out. println ( x) ;
}
}
}
打印三角形
public class LabeDemo1 {
public static void main ( String[ ] args) {
for ( int i = 1 ; i <= 5 ; i++ ) {
for ( int j = 5 ; j >= i ; j-- ) {
System. out. print ( " " ) ;
}
for ( int j= 1 ; j<= i; j++ ) {
System. out. print ( "*" ) ;
}
for ( int j = 1 ; j< i; j++ ) {
System. out. print ( "*" ) ;
}
System. out. println ( ) ;
}
}
}